Short-term debt and current portion of long-term debt

Cigna Short-term debt and current portion of long-term debt increased by 158.3% to $1.53B in Q1 2026 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ric declined by 61.7%, from $3.99B to $1.53B. Over 5 years (FY 2020 to FY 2025), Short-term debt and current portion of long-term debt shows a downward trend with a -29.4% CAGR. This increase may warrant attention — for this metric, lower values are generally preferred.

How to read this metric

High levels of current debt relative to cash flow can signal liquidity risk, while lower levels suggest a more manageable debt maturity profile.
